The NCAA has a legal monopoly on professional football players in the prime years of their adult athletic careers right now. 18-21 year old NFL level talented athletes do not have options in America to earn a living playing football. They’d have to leave the country or play in NCAA for a “scholarship.” It’s a fucked up system when you think about it.
